There should've been a class action lawsuit against Wally World for selling that FLW jacket as a rain suit. For me, it didn't work in ANY kind of rain. I took it back after its first use.
i got the pro qualifier bass pro suit back in the early spring and although it was too much money,it has been some of the best money i have ever spent.i really like it,and would buy it again in a heartbeat.very comfortable,dry even in a driving rain,and great for cold mornings.the hood makes a mask around the face,and it is great.
The money I spent on a 100 MPH suit is the best money I have spent on fishing. I am sure the Cabelas is good too. If you are going to be out in the weather you need a good suit. The other stuff is ok for pop up showers but if you plan on fishing in rain get a 100 MPH or guideware.

Bought the bps extreme 10 yrs ago and abuse it often. Still bone dry, shows very little wear zippers still work perfectly. They smell a little though last couple years. Well over $400 and worth it.
I got the bass pro shop pro quailifier. I love it it is alittle cheaper than the 100 mph and it also has a zipper in the front. I tried on the 100 mph bibs and there is a piece of neoprene sewn in the front . You have to take them down which means removing the jacket to go to the bathroom. In the pouring rain that is a pain.

i use bass pro gortex pack lite and pants. Store nice and flat little space Hood with viser, draw string with velcro to close up around face very pleased. Do get a little wet when running boat . Paid less than $150
only goretex and quality. save up and buy a cabelas guide gear or bass pro 100 mph gore tex rain suit. it will save you money in the long run to buy a quality rain suit and gore tex is guaranteed never to leak.
The bass pro 100mph is the best i have found. I used to use the frogg toggs but they ended up ripping in the crotch area, they worked ok for light showers, but the heavy down pours i got wet. The 100mph works great in all types of rain and keeps you warm when its cold out.
